Transaction 2005c973cb241adb5bf165164d3a05889962178a566d7fb087305a3a01be5c91
1 Input
1 Output
-
2005c973cb241adb5bf165164d3a05889962178a566d7fb087305a3a01be5c91:0
- value
- 688993
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a8fcb83c35ec2a9c9f88638f30491a1ccde7382 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DdeWXL5rYwXVBfD3RSp3ZgNd2kWTtUBux